1,032,952 is a composite number, even.
1,032,952 (one million thirty-two thousand nine hundred fifty-two) is an even 7-digit number. It is a composite number with 8 divisors, and factors as 2³ × 129,119. Written other ways, in hexadecimal, 0xFC2F8.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 1032952, here are decompositions:
- 3 + 1032949 = 1032952
- 71 + 1032881 = 1032952
- 101 + 1032851 = 1032952
- 113 + 1032839 = 1032952
- 149 + 1032803 = 1032952
- 251 + 1032701 = 1032952
- 269 + 1032683 = 1032952
- 443 + 1032509 = 1032952
Showing the first eight; more decompositions exist.
